
Dark bertema, Seo Friendly: Nuxt Content + TailwindCSS + Firebase + I18n Spa berbasis untuk menunda -nunda pengembang untuk dengan cepat memutar blog kickass mereka sendiri dan memamerkan proyek mereka.

Kunjungi: template.karngyan.com untuk melihat semua fitur yang diaktifkan versi templat ini.
# replace <username> with your username
git clone [email protected]: < username > /karngyan.com.git
git checkout -b website # install node <= 14 and yarn (highly recommended)
$ npm install --global yarn
# cd into your project and install the dependencies
$ yarn install
# run the dev server
$ yarn dev
# open localhost:3000Halaman mungkin tidak memuat sekarang, Anda dapat mengatur
firebase.enabled = falsedikarngyan.config.jsuntuk saat ini. Baca bersama.
karngyan.config.js sesuai keinginan Anda. Anda dapat menghidupkan dan mematikan bagian/halaman dengan mengubah nilai enabled untuk objek masing -masing.static . Itu cocok dengan root saat digunakan.strings sesuai.firebase.enabled = false di karngyan.config.js , dan pindah ke langkah berikutnya. Jika tidak, ikuti ini: rules_version = '2';
service cloud.firestore {
match /databases/{database}/documents {
match /likes/{id} {
allow write: if request.auth != null;
allow read: if true;
}
match /comments/{id} {
allow write: if request.auth != null &&
request.resourse.data.text.size() > 0 &&
request.resource.data.slug.size() > 0;
allow read: if true;
}
}
}
.env.example -> .env dan tambahkan nilai dari objek config.websitedistyarn generatecontent/posts dan proyek dalam content/projects dalam penurunan harga atau HTML. Ada beberapa sampel yang datang dengan template.Kode adalah milik Anda, edit apa pun yang Anda rasakan. Jangan lupa untuk membintangi repositori jika Anda menyukainya.
Proyek ini menggunakan konten Nuxt, Anda dapat membacanya di sini
Anda juga dapat mengatur kehutanan untuk tidak pernah membuka kode dan menggunakan editor keren. Saya akan menambahkan instruksi untuk menggunakannya nanti.
Situs web saya sendiri Karngyan.com sebenarnya digunakan pada AWS dalam ember S3, dengan Cloudfront. Tapi itu datang dengan beberapa peringatan untuk dikonfigurasi dan dipelihara. Ngomong -ngomong, Gulpfile.js untuk digunakan AWS berkomitmen dengan proyek jika Anda merasa ingin memeriksanya.
Kontribusi inilah yang membuat komunitas open source menjadi tempat yang luar biasa untuk dipelajari, menginspirasi, dan menciptakan. Kontribusi apa pun yang Anda buat sangat dihargai .
git checkout -b feature/AmazingFeature )git commit -m 'Add some AmazingFeature' )git push origin feature/AmazingFeature )Naikkan PR ketika situs web Anda siap untuk menambahkan Anda di sini.
Temukan posisi abjad Anda, atau angkat PR untuk mengotomatisasi ini.
Didistribusikan di bawah lisensi MIT. Lihat LICENSE untuk informasi lebih lanjut.
Karn - @Gegnarn - [email protected]
Untuk penjelasan terperinci tentang cara kerja, lihat dokumen Nuxt.js.